Women’s lacrosse has been one of the best athletic programs at UNC in recent years, with the Tar Heels capturing NCAA Championships in 2013, 2016 and 2022.

The Tar Heels have also been a model of consistency, making every NCAA Tournament since 2005. They’ve produced career record-holders in the past five seasons, including Jamie Ortega (goals, points), Katie Hoeg (assists), Taylor Moreno (saves) and Ally Mastroianni (draw controls).

All of the above stars have since graduated, but the latter two are still continuing to capture headlines in the lacrosse world.

On Friday, Sept. 29, Moreno and Mastroianni were named to the USA Lacrosse roster for the World Lacrosse Super Sixes event.

The Super Sixes will take place from Friday, Oct. 6-Sunday, Oct. 8 in Oshawa, Canada. USA will compete against the likes of Canada, India, Haiti, Kenya and Haudenosaunee, a Native American tribe located predominantly in Upstate New York.

Mastroianni and Ortega both played at Carolina from 2018-2022. Mastroianni holds the school record with 360 draw controls, while Ortega, arguably the greatest offensive player to come through Chapel Hill, holds school records with 334 goals and 466 points.
